Why intercompany reconciliation
Answer / pravin ninawe
Intercomany reconciliation is reconciling between the two
branches of the same company located in multiple locations.
where as one branch acts as seller to other branch when
some product is moved from Branch A to B branch.
Eg:- when Branch A sends some products to Branch B then in
this case. Branch A becomes the seller and Branch B becomes
the purchaser.
Hence we need to reconcile between these two branches to
ensure the right figures appear on the financial statments
to the management
